Tallulah was given an ultimatum by her parents to seek help at a treatment center or they would take away everything from her, reported People magazine.
"Tallulah was pretty much given an ultimatum. Her parents were about to take away everything from her," a family friend said.
Tallulah reportedly checked into a treatment center, The Meadows, in Arizona in late July to seek help for her alcohol and cocaine issues. The 20-year-old fashion blogger did post a cryptic "bai bai" message in one of her last tweets on July 23.
"When Demi was hospitalised, Tallulah didn't show up to school for days because she was too embarrassed. She was very open about Demi's issues and would sort of imply, 'Of course I have issues too, look at my mom'," the friend said.
Moore and Willis have visited Tallulah at the rehab.
